Wire Basket Transformation

Start with a sturdy metal wire basket, which offers excellent ventilation to keep your items dry between uses. You can hang it at your preferred height using strong adhesive hooks that do not damage the wall, or install a simple tension rod across the back of your shower wall for extra stability. For a cleaner look, wrap the handles with coordinating twine or thin rope to add grip and a touch of rustic detail. This project is one of the most flexible shower caddy ideas because you can easily swap the basket for a different size or color as your style evolves.

Wood Crate Shelving Unit

Stack wooden crates vertically on a reinforced shelf or sturdy towel bar to create tiered storage for different categories of products. Secure the stack carefully so it does not wobble, and consider adding non slip shelf liner inside each crate to prevent bottles from sliding. Use waterproof sealant on the wood to protect it from constant steam, which helps the piece last longer in a humid environment. This layout works especially well as a small shower caddy solution for counters outside the main spray area, keeping the floor clear and the space feeling open.

Floating Shelf Caddy

Install two or three waterproof floating shelves at varying heights to create a structured ledge for your shower essentials. You can use the same materials throughout the bathroom to create a cohesive design language, making the storage feel like a natural part of the architecture. Place the largest shelf in the middle for bulkier items and use the upper and lower shelves for smaller accessories or decorative touches. This approach is ideal if you are looking for a minimalist shower caddy storage idea that keeps the visual clutter to a minimum while maximizing utility.

Hook and Rail System

Mount a slim rail or wooden board to the wall and equip it with a selection of hooks in different shapes and sizes. This configuration allows you to hang shower pouches, loofahs, and hooks for shaving gear with total flexibility, rearranging as needed when your storage requirements change. You can paint the rail to match your fixtures or leave it in a natural finish to add warmth to the space. As one of the most adaptable hanging shower caddy solutions, this system grows with your needs, whether you are setting up a guest bath or updating your primary bathroom.

Door Mounted Organizers

The shower door itself can become a vertical storage surface with the help of over the door caddy or hanging pockets. These units attach securely without drilling, making them a renter friendly option for quick improvement. Look for versions with multiple pockets or clear sections so you can easily see what is inside each compartment, reducing the time spent searching for items. They are especially useful for travel sized products and frequently used extras that you want to access without stepping fully into the spray.

Corner Niches and Slim Trays

Utilize often neglected corners by installing a slim wire rack or fitting a custom cut niche into the wall during a renovation. A narrow ledge in the corner can hold a single large bottle or a small basket of accessories, turning an awkward gap into a functional feature. Select materials that complement your existing hardware, such as matching metals or coordinated colors, to ensure the addition feels intentional rather than improvised. This strategy is perfect for maximizing every inch of a small bathroom shower caddy layout without compromising the design cohesion.
